Woke up this morning to another blanket of smoke over the city.

Everyone's got a cough, it's been affecting everyone.

Just when it looked like it was clearing up, and it was grand to have a few days of clear(er) air, now it's back again.

Mr Wizard called me last night to talk about the outdoor show on Saturday. We have to look at the options AGAIN. Ye gods.

Smoke is starting to become a factor in our planning.

It's not that Sydney hasn't had bushfires before, some have probably even come a little closer to the centre of town than this recent lot, it's the inescapable, cough inducing smog.

It's necessitated a trip to the doctor for at least one band family member.

The sunlight has been orange for weeks, hanging clothes out on the line is inadvisable and everyone's buying Masks for breathing.

Up in the mountains, they did back burning and lost another 20 houses.

Oh yeah and yesterday was Australia's hottest day on record.

Not much to do but to wait it out. Our thoughts remain with the people closer to the front line of the burning and the firey's out there trying to do something about it.

We're waiting to see how the air is for Saturday before we venture outside.

if you're in Sydney, stay safe and indoors if you can.

I can't bring myself to say all the stuff that is on my mind when doing the tour planning.

It's some logistical Kung Fu, I tell ya.

Each time we do this I genuinely question my capacity to manage the process. If anyone tells you this is easy, please give them my number.

I am fairly sure I have written that, here, before.

Dates, equipment, transport, other logistics. Yikes.

As I was resolving the Next problem that arose today (it always happens) I flashed back to when we had to can the 2017 Tour 7 days before, when one of the guys had a health scare. That was actually a pretty easy decision, even factoring all the work that had gone into it.

That makes me feel pretty comfortable that we can make the hard calls when we need to.

 

 

At the same time, the little things like figuring out how to make distance and travel with 6+ people and a car load of gear in US Winter is giving me some pause for thought.

At least the smoke here has dropped off somewhat. Only just noticed the birds are singing again.

Ok, so, back to the calcs, miles to the Gallon, distance and....(sigh).

Whose bright idea was this? Oh yeah we won that comp thing. Right.

I did a show outside during the smoke, 3 weeks back. I'm still recovering.

It does no good for singing whatsoever; I'm not doing that again.

This has been a totally bonkers period, I don't think anyone predicted 'smoke' as a reason to cancel a show.

We'll be monitoring conditions over the next couple of days and will post up here depending on outcome.

It was just plain dangerous yesterday and only 'hazy' today, which was about the same conditions as the last time I tried it.

If conditions continue as they are, it'll be a No from me, which will bum us all out. 

Even so, our thoughts first and foremost are with the firefighters and the folks who have been affected by this 'perfect firestorm'.

Bloody heck.
